C-99, Sarita Vihar, , Delhi - 110076, Delhi, India
Office Number 2977, South Patel Nagar, , Delhi - 110008, Delhi, India
7/59, Amar Colony-lajpat Nagar, , Delhi - 110024, Delhi, India
646, Dr Mukherjee Nagar, , Delhi - 110009, Delhi, India
Flat no A-54, Pocket A, Sarita Vihar, , Delhi - 110076, Delhi, India